How can I be happy when faced with difficult circumstances?

2 Corinthians 12:9-10Each time he said, “My grace is all you need. My power works best in weakness.” So now I am glad to boast about my weaknesses, so that the power of Christ can work through me. That’s why I take pleasure in my weaknesses, and in the insults, hardships, persecutions, and troubles that I suffer for Christ. For when I am weak, then I am strong.

James 1:2-4Dear brothers and sisters, when troubles come your way, consider it an opportunity for great joy. For you know that when your faith is tested, your endurance has a chance to grow. So let it grow, for when your endurance is fully developed, you will be perfect and complete, needing nothing.

God uses adversity to grow us in faith, perseverance, and spiritual maturity. We can always rejoice in what we will gain through our struggles.

James 1:12God blesses those who patiently endure testing and temptation. Afterward they will receive the crown of life that God has promised to those who love him.

1 Peter 4:12-13Dear friends, don’t be surprised at the fiery trials you are going through, as if something strange were happening to you. Instead, be very glad—for these trials make you partners with Christ in his suffering, so that you will have the wonderful joy of seeing his glory when it is revealed to all the world.

God promises a greater reward for those who endure difficult circumstances because of their faith. Temporary suffering will be replaced by a greater joy that lasts forever. Anticipating these rewards makes us happier even in the midst of adversity.

Romans 5:2Because of our faith, Christ has brought us into this place of undeserved privilege where we now stand, and we confidently and joyfully look forward to sharing God’s glory.

Hebrews 10:34You suffered along with those who were thrown into jail, and when all you owned was taken from you, you accepted it with joy. You knew there were better things waiting for you that will last forever.

Hope in God’s promises of eternal life can make us happy because we know that what we are presently going through will one day end.

Acts 5:41The apostles left the high council rejoicing that God had counted them worthy to suffer disgrace for the name of Jesus.

When we live in such a way that even our suffering brings honor to Jesus, he has a special place of honor for us that will bring us a deep sense of joy.

Daniel 12:3“Those who are wise will shine as bright as the sky, and those who lead many to righteousness will shine like the stars forever.”

Matthew 5:16“In the same way, let your good deeds shine out for all to see, so that everyone will praise your heavenly Father.”

We can be happy because we know this world is not all there is. We know something better is coming. We should practice letting God’s light shine through us. Then, others will see that no matter what’s happening in the world around us, we are happy in the knowledge of a future in heaven.

Matthew 6:19-21“Don’t store up treasures here on earth, where moths eat them and rust destroys them, and where thieves break in and steal. Store your treasures in heaven, where moths and rust cannot destroy, and thieves do not break in and steal. Wherever your treasure is, there the desires of your heart will also be.”

True happiness comes from the confident assurance that what is really valuable is waiting for us in heaven. We can hoard material possessions here on earth and have little waiting for us in heaven, or we can send our wealth on ahead for eternal enjoyment by obeying and serving God right now.
